Former NFL quarterback Colin Kaepernick continues to make headlines as he continues his journey back into the National Football League world. He has been part of rumors, offers, and controversy trying to do so. A report has come out that a former New England Patriots star is calling for Kaepernick to sign with the New York Jets. Ty Law has made it clear that he is not a fan of current quarterback Zach Wilson and has called upon Kaepernick to keep trying to sign with the team.
"Bring back Kaepernick!"
Ty Law has not been impressed by Jets quarterback Zach Wilson and has an idea of who New York could sign to replace him! pic.twitter.com/m1OdIXhAAq— The Greg Hill Show (@TheGregHillShow) September 26, 2023
Ty Law Comments
Law went on “The Greg Hill Show” to express his thoughts on the Jets quarterback situation. The former star said, “They just need to go ahead and make a splash. You got Aaron Rodgers, all this hype. ‘Hard Knocks,’ you’re doing all of that good stuff. Might as well keep it going, man. Bring back (Colin) Kaepernick.”
Kaepernick reached out to the team after Rodgers went down, but the Jets did not seem interested. He had rapper J Cole send out a letter to the team asking them if he could join their practice squad. The offer was ultimately turned down which shut down all of the rumors of Kaepernick joining the team.
Colin Kaepernick’s Comeback Attempt
Kaepernick has been bouncing around different professional football leagues since the letter was released. He even met with XFL owner Dwayne Johnson to discuss potentially playing in the league. Johnson came out after the meeting and said it most likely will not happen. Kaepernick ultimately wanted a bigger paycheck that the XFL could not offer him and turned down the offer.
He has since been added to the negotiation list of the CFL team, the B.C. Lions. He will most likely turn down this offer as well for similar reasons. He has been part of NFL rumors with fans for certain teams calling for him to play for them. Some potential suitors include the New York Jets, New England Patriots, and Arizona Cardinals. We will see what Kaepernick decides to do as the season continues.
